In the 1970s, Angela flees from her Neapolitan base, wanting to leave ugly memories behind and rebuild her life in Rome. But someone cannot forget her: Carmine (an unscrupulous young boss) and John (a thirsty commissioner of justice). When Angela returns to Naples with her husband Gabriele, she struggles for the survival of her family. Carmine, defying the power of boss Conticello and Nina's love, will stop at nothing to have Angela at her side.
